Prometheus is a leading open source tool for monitoring and alerting. Originally, it was developed at SoundCloud and was later open sourced. It is also part of Cloud Native Computing Foundation (CNCF), like Kubernetes.
You can aggregate data received from various sources, such as Spring Boot metrics, hystrix.stream, and so on, in time-series fashion, which is identifiable by the metric names and key-value pairs.
